About the Book

Jude's newest book intertwines her words with the paintings of Nicholas Jennings. Reviewer Pauline LeBel writes:

"Jude Neale finds inspiration in the beauty of Nicholas Jennings' paintings, evoking tender memories of her life on the island: the gathering of pebbles in a drawstring purse; skipping stones onto the mirrored sea with her five-year-old; the summer when her paddles held dragonflies."

The poems in Water Forgets Its Own Name reflect on nature, memory, and the passage of time, with water as a central metaphor for forgetting and remembering, flowing and returning.
